Pleiotropy

Pleiotropy is the phenomenon in which a single gene impacts multiple, seemingly unrelated phenotypic traits. For example, defects in the SOX10 gene cause Waardenburg Syndrome Type 4, or WS4, which can cause defects in pigmentation, hearing impairments, and an absence of intestinal contractions necessary for elimination. Epistasis

In addition to multiple alleles at the same locus influencing traits, numerous genes or alleles at different locations may interact and influence phenotypes in a phenomenon called epistasis. For example, rabbit fur can be black or brown depending on whether the animal is homozygous dominant or heterozygous at a TYRP1 locus. Psoriasis in identical twins: simultaneous occurrence on same sites.

S Singh1, R V Singh, S S Pandey

  • 1Department of Dermatology and Venereology, Institute of Medical Sciences, Banaras Hindu University, Varanasi-221005, India.

Indian Journal of Dermatology, Venereology and Leprology
|October 16, 2010
PubMed
Summary

This case study highlights psoriasis in identical twins, presenting with distinctive foot sole plaques. Histopathology confirmed the diagnosis, underscoring the importance of accurate diagnostic methods.

Area of Science:

  • Dermatology
  • Genetics

Background:

  • Psoriasis is a chronic inflammatory skin condition.
  • Plantar psoriasis, affecting the soles of the feet, can be challenging to diagnose and treat.
  • Genetic factors are implicated in psoriasis development.

Purpose of the Study:

  • To present a case of psoriasis in identical twins.
  • To describe the clinical presentation and histopathological findings of plantar psoriasis.

Main Methods:

  • Clinical observation of two 12-year-old identical male twins.
  • Histopathological examination of skin biopsy specimens from affected foot soles.

Main Results:

  • Both twins presented with simultaneous onset of dull erythematous plaques with coarse scaling and deep fissuring on their foot soles.
  • Histopathological examination confirmed the diagnosis of psoriasis.

Conclusions:

  • Identical twins can present with similar dermatological conditions like psoriasis.
  • Histopathological confirmation is crucial for diagnosing plantar psoriasis.
  • This case emphasizes the potential genetic predisposition in psoriasis.
